Lambton were hosting
division rival and the team chasing them in the
standings, the Chatham-Kent Cyclones. Lambton needed
to win to improve their point total, keep a safe
distance in front of Chatham-Kent and to try to move
up in the standings.
Lambton got off to a good start with Brennan McKegan
laying out a couple of CK Cyclones and generating a
number of offensive opportunities. Unfortunately no
Lambton players were able to put the puck in the
net. The first period ended in a 0-0 tie.
That was it for highlights as Chatham scored three
times in the second and shut-down Lambton in the
third period for a 3-0 win.
Ethan Williams was solid in net.
